Avoid using frameworks – a guide for developers in coding and programming #javascript #devin #ai

Posted by



When it comes to coding and programming, many developers rely on frameworks to streamline their workflows and make their jobs easier. Frameworks can be incredibly helpful in organizing code, providing pre-built components and libraries, and helping developers adhere to best practices. However, for some developers, relying too heavily on frameworks can stifle creativity, hinder understanding of underlying technologies, and limit their ability to think critically about how code is structured and executed.

If you’re someone who has become too dependent on frameworks and wants to break free from that reliance, you’re not alone. Many developers have found themselves in the same situation, feeling like they’ve lost touch with the fundamentals of coding and programming. The good news is that it’s never too late to change your approach and become a more versatile developer. In this tutorial, we’ll explore how to stop worrying about frameworks and start embracing a more hands-on, DIY approach to coding.

1. Understand the Basics: Before you can start coding without a framework, it’s important to have a solid understanding of the fundamentals of coding and programming. Make sure you’re familiar with core concepts such as variables, loops, functions, and data structures. If you’re unsure about any of these concepts, take the time to review them and practice writing code from scratch without relying on a framework.

2. Break Free from Dependency: One of the biggest hurdles in transitioning away from frameworks is breaking the habit of reaching for them every time you start a new project. Begin by challenging yourself to build a simple project without using any frameworks. This could be a basic website, a small application, or a straightforward coding challenge. Embrace the opportunity to get your hands dirty and write code from scratch, even if it takes longer and feels more challenging at first.

3. Explore Core Technologies: To become a more well-rounded developer, it’s essential to explore core technologies and languages without the help of frameworks. Dive deeper into JavaScript, HTML, CSS, or any other programming language you work with regularly. Look for opportunities to experiment with different techniques, tools, and methodologies to expand your skill set and deepen your understanding of how code works behind the scenes.

4. Embrace Flexibility and Adaptability: One of the biggest benefits of coding without a framework is the freedom to be flexible and adaptive in your approach. Don’t be afraid to experiment, tinker, and refactor your code as needed. Trust your instincts, rely on your problem-solving skills, and be open to trying new things. Embrace the challenge of solving problems on your own and discovering creative solutions without the crutch of a framework.

5. Stay Curious and Keep Learning: Finally, remember that coding is a dynamic and ever-evolving field, and there’s always something new to learn. Stay curious, seek out opportunities for continuous learning, and be proactive in expanding your knowledge and expertise. Whether it’s taking online courses, attending workshops, or collaborating with other developers, make a commitment to growing your skills and staying ahead of the curve.

In conclusion, breaking free from the dependency on frameworks is a rewarding journey that can lead to personal and professional growth as a developer. By embracing a more hands-on, DIY approach to coding, you’ll gain a deeper understanding of core technologies, enhance your problem-solving skills, and become a more versatile and adaptable programmer. So don’t worry about being a framework user – instead, embrace the challenge of coding without a safety net and watch your skills soar to new heights.

0 0 votes
Article Rating
23 Comments
Oldest
Newest Most Voted
Inline Feedbacks
View all comments
@vulturebeast
1 month ago

Jai Shree Ram❤

@prajwalitsinghraja3196
1 month ago

Jai Bajrangbali ❤️

@adityapandey9383
1 month ago

Jay shree raam bhai

@socksareharder3663
1 month ago

Udh jaye bhai web development udh jaye bas bhai bohot hogaya sala bas udh jaye AI se sukoon se marte wey optimised website banaloonga

@Mandeeptakare1795
1 month ago

Devin hi ud gaya sab fake nikala 😂

@hussnainkhurshid5068
1 month ago

Monkey worshiper detected opinion rejected

@godslayerpvp
1 month ago

bhai konsa tent hai

@jafferpatel6017
1 month ago

VCs thodina AI use karege

@shivamchawla3171
1 month ago

i agree with him 4 year tak aate aate picture clear hone lagti hai

@sohamshahapure3499
1 month ago

Sir pccoe cs in regional language bhetlay , opportunities same asnar na?

@Indus00000
1 month ago

Sir should I take paid courses or learning from YouTube is also ok

@killpad500
1 month ago

3:47:43

@Sandeepsingh-fl2hs
1 month ago

Mean while Purav jha beat Ai in every thing… 😂

@sksahinparvej5500
1 month ago

Devin khud ur gaya 🤣

@sundrampandey9815
1 month ago

bhai ignore kyu kare, ye to achhi baat hai

@himalayanmonk3350
1 month ago

Update: Devin was a scam 😂

@pritambala4471
1 month ago

Brother devin can ake only you college project! When you will come real world's project then you can know tha what level of projects we makes. Just want to give a overview that i have been working in a project over 8-9 months, based on react also some time i works in backend with spring boot for the same project, for the project our team size is 30-50

@jawwadkhan7453
1 month ago

Bhai today was my interview and I was rejected but when I see you my motivational level boost up

@abacas2175
1 month ago

Hanuman ji ke charado mai fisal gya hoga,,,matha sedhe dharti pe pada hoga aur Nariyal ke paise bhi bach gye honge😂

@theuncencoredvirus
1 month ago

🗣️: Devin will replace all the coders
Me: I'll call him JARVIS 😂